Hi and welcome to the forum. From what I saw, it is listed as a gamer as is and the specs did seem pretty good for a laptop. Good processor, not sure of the Graphics package, but seems pretty good. The memory could be upgraded to 2 Gb. Adding extra USB ports could be problematic due to the power supply, as it may not be enough to support the extra USB items that may be plugged in. coastie65
